"Absolute Mayhem The Horse & Chains, Bushey on Saturday 30 September 2023 It's a rare thing to go into a local pub and hear a keyboard player who has been described as a musical "genius" by none other than David Bowie. This is no tall story either. The musician Billy Ritchie was the first player in rock music to give keyboards a prominent role -- and that was before Keith Emerson (ELP) and Rick Wakeman came on the scene. Billy told me that he remained good friends with the Thin White Duke until his death in 2016. Lanark-born Mr Ritchie now provides the skilful and fancy keyboards and records backing tracks for his latest incarnation Mayhem with talented female singer Carol Leslie. Carol is a really strong vocalist with a gutsy style. This dynamic duo started their first set at the cosy Sebright Arms with Elvis's late sixties' classic Suspicious Minds. The second song was a surprise -- Kirsty MacColl's comedy number There's A Guy Works Down The Chip Shop Swears His Elvis. It was a perfect choice after the first song. Carol and Billy select their material wisely and give their audience something very different from the predictable Mustang Sally, Brown Eyed Girl and I Saw Her Standing There, churned out by so many pub bands. So it was great to hear Georgio Moroder and Phil Oakey's electro smash Together In Electric Dreams, Matchbox's catchy rocker Rockabilly Rebel, Starship's uplifting We Built This City (on which Billy demonstrated his keyboard dexterity) and Solomon Burke's gospel-ish Cry To Me. And that was just the first half. Carol is happy to tackle songs usually associated with male vocalists and she started part two with a raucous version of Bryan Adams' rocker Summer Of 69. If you have never seen Mayhem, ask Billy to perform Light My Fire, the Doors rock classic from 1967. This was a sheer musical masterclass as he re-created both vocally and instrumentally this great song. Billy has a rich, tuneful voice and this was a stunning performance. Other highlights in the second half included Journey's rock anthem Don't Stop Believing, Carol's gritty interpretation if Shania Twain's Man I Feel Like A Woman and a fine performance of Bon Jovi's Living On A Prayer A total of 24 songs and I cannot wait to see this duo again. My only concern is their name. I think many club and pubgoers might think Mayhem are a heavy metal band rather than an all-round, top class duo.
